So...what is budapest like in the christmastime? We're thinking of spending a week in either your city or prague...

Budababe · 18/10/2007 16:54

It's nice here at Christmas. May be very cold and may have snow or may not! Some Xmas markets on. For the Hungarians, Xmas Eve is their big day - although most homes will have decorations up the tree only goes up on Xmas Eve and they have a big dinner - usually fish.

Most of the hotels here do Xmas lunch/brunch.

Have to say I have only had one Xmas here as I tend to go home and the one Xmas I did have here I had all my family here so was a bit busy!

BudaBabe - get DH to check before he buys a SatNav. I suggested DH buy me a TomTom for my birthday (sad I know), he baulked when he realised how many varieties there are. More importantly when I bothered to research on- line I realised most are loaded with the standard western europe map i.e stops at the Austrian/Hungary/Slovak etc borders. If you want east of Austria you need to be failry specific on model etc.
